Demographics — College

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, College has a population of 707, which has decreased by -47.9% over the past 5 years. College is a less popular place for families, as children make up 6.2% of the population. The area has a highly educated workforce, with 87.1% of adult residents holding a bachelor’s degree or higher. There are few residents working remotely, with 2.0% reporting working from home.

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, College is a predominantly white area, with 43.3% of the population identifying as white. The white population has shrunk by 24.7% in the last 5 years. The second most common race or ethnicity in College is asian, making up 26.0% of the population. Foreign-born residents account for 27.4% of the population in College, and this percentage has increased by 101.5% as of the ACS Survey 5 years prior, suggesting more immigrants are calling the area home.
